Policing Re-organisation

Hounslow, Ealing and Hillingdon are among  the first London boroughs to be brought together under a new policing structure. The Hounslow Borough Commander, Raj Kohl, becomes the new Neighbourhoods Superintendent for all three boroughs. A new Basic Command Unit  (BCU)…
